Abstract :
THE purpose of this paper is to outline procedures and discuss pertinent problems that arise when restoring service to a metropolitan system following a major shutdown. In the discussion, consideration is given to the fundamental plan of the system, pointing out the inherent features in the design which prevent such failures. Several cases of trouble which have been the cause of service curtailment have been discussed and the service restoration procedure outlined. A brief outline of the essential procedure is given for two types of service restoration.
